Kaspersky Lab recently introduced the latest edition of the company's security platform, dubbed as Kaspersky Small Office Security (KSOS), designed specifically to serve the needs of small businesses with less than twenty five employees.
<br />
<br />
The platform is user-friendly and provides <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/category/top-facts/tech-innovation/">excellent protection</a>. It also makes much easier for small businesses to keep track on their valuable information while keeping the customer, employee and operations data protected.
<br />
<br />
Senior Product Marketing Manager at Kaspersky Lab North America, Andrey Pozhogin said that it requires a lot of effort and expertise to create a working solution out of available single-purpose applications.
<br />
<br />
One might need to protect Windows and Mac-based workstations, mobile devices, have clean virtual machines set up for online banking, create a backup solution, encrypt sensitive data and use time consuming IT policies regarding the use of strong passwords. This type of policy can be changed with a password manager that will not just recommend the use of strong and unique passwords, but will also save a lot of time.
<br />
<br />
The updated version of Kaspersky Small Office Security includes enhanced protection from all known, unknown and advanced threats, with multi-layered protection for Windows and Mac computers, servers and Android-based mobile devices. A cloud-based management console that allows users manage IT security and devices anywhere with a web browser.
<br />
<br />
It also has a new cloud-based password management that holds important company login information and enables users to have a different, unique password for every secure site, across all devices, while only needing to remember one master-password.
<br />
<br />
Furthermore, the platform provides security for financial data that protects online business and personal transaction from financial fraud through its improved 'Safe Money' module.
<br />
<br />
KSOS protects Windows-based or Mac-based desktops or notebooks, Windows file servers, and Android smartphones and tablets. Each user will get protection for one Windows or Mac computer and one mobile device and Kaspersky Password Manager. File Server protection is included based on the number of protected users.
<br />
<br />
In a nutshell, the solution provides anti-malware and online transaction security, cloud management, backup and password management. It is also straightforward to install, simple to configure, and easy to maintain.

<span style="font-size: 12.0pt; line-height: 107%; mso-bidi-font-size: 11.0pt;">The search giant recently released
a new Chrome extension, dubbed Password Alert, designed to serve as an early
warning system against phishing attacks wherein it can detect if you're using
your Google password on any non-Google site.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<span style="font-size: 12.0pt; line-height: 107%; mso-bidi-font-size: 11.0pt;">Product manager of Google Ideas,
Justin Kosslyn said that phishing should be a real concern for everyone. He
also defined the project as a useful and quiet line of defense against a real
challenge.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<span style="font-size: 12.0pt; line-height: 107%; mso-bidi-font-size: 11.0pt;">If the extension detects that you
have entered your Gmail password to anywhere other than accounts.google.com, it
will redirect you to a warning page and will tell you that your password was
just exposed and you should immediately reset your password to keep your Gmail
account secure. You can ignore the alert if you are sure you've not been
hacked. Gmail users can also mute website alerts.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<span style="font-size: 12.0pt; line-height: 107%; mso-bidi-font-size: 11.0pt;">Because Password Alert only keeps
the hashed version of your password, it can execute the scan without revealing
your actual password to any further risk. Any individual using Google for work
account can also make a Password Alert mandatory across their domain. Each time
an employee gets an alert, same goes with the administrator.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<span style="font-size: 12.0pt; line-height: 107%; mso-bidi-font-size: 11.0pt;">Here is the bad news, Password
Alert biggest weakness is that it can only scan a password that has been
successfully submitted, so the user will only be alerted after they have been
successfully phished. However, even a late warning will give users the chance
and time to change their passwords and lock down their accounts before any
damage is done. For users with two-step verification, it should be easy to
change the password before the attackers can exploit it.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<span style="font-size: 12.0pt; line-height: 107%; mso-bidi-font-size: 11.0pt;">The extension could also heighten
security outside of Google accounts. It is built to integrate with Google's
password system, but the code is open source, so it should be easy to adapt the
code to other systems.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<span style="font-size: 12.0pt; line-height: 107%; mso-bidi-font-size: 11.0pt;">Kosslyn states that they hope the
open-source community scales Password Alert to provide additional security to
internet users.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="text-align: justify;">
<span style="font-size: 12.0pt; line-height: 107%; mso-bidi-font-size: 11.0pt;">Google increased its security
practices in October with the release of Security Key. If you are making use of
Google's 2-step verification method, you can choose Security Key as your
primary method, rather than having verification codes sent to your phone. With
Security Key, you can simply insert your Security Key into your computer's USB
port when requested. Security Key provides better protection against phishing
attacks, because it uses cryptography instead of verification codes and automatically
works only with the website it's supposed to work with.<o:p></o:p></span></div>

<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">A
sophisticated bank scam that uses a combination of the Dyre malware, phishing
tactics and fake bank representatives has been uncovered by IBM researchers.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;"><a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/">IBM's Security Group</a> has released
information about a new variant of Dyre malware, initially uncovered last year,
dubbed as "Dyre Wolf" that targets large companies and organizations.
It basically social engineers employees into handing over their personal
banking data from which the scammers will arrange a large wire transfer.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">In a
blog post by Lance Mueller and John Kuhn of IBM, the scheme's details were made
known to the public. It all starts with the usual mass emails that contain
links or attachments that will install the <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/">Dyre malware</a> when clicked. Once it is
installed on the PC, it just sits there and waits for the time when a bank's
website gets accessed.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">Dyre
is programmed to keep tabs on hundreds of bank websites so once an infected PC
tries to access one of them, it can replace the page with one that provides a
support number the victim should call. This is where the sophisticated social
engineering comes in, where the person pretending to be a representative of the
victim's bank gets the latter's banking credentials. What's more, a wire
transfer from the victim's account is done while they are talking on the phone.
The transfer travels from one foreign bank to another so as to prevent
detection by authorities. On some occasions, the company will even suffer a
DDoS attack to avoid discovering the wire transfer early on.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">From
Hendren Global Group Top Facts' data, it appears that a total of USD 1 million
has already been stolen using this scheme. Such big success of the scheme
serves as proof that companies have to make sure their employees are
well-trained in spotting suspicious emails or activities.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">As
IBM's Caleb Barlow said, "Organizations are only as strong as their
weakest link, and in this case, it's their employees."<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><br /></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">Unfortunately,
Hendren Global Group Top Facts confirmed that, at present, this particular
strain of Dyre Wolf is still undetected by most antivirus software.</span></div>

<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">According
to the news from The Economist, entitled “Economic Convergence: Economic
Headwinds Return”, “Ten years ago, developing economies were catching up with
developed ones remarkably quickly. It was an aberration.”<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">Reviewing
the decade-and-a-half journey of China from a lagging economy to one that has
surpassed many nations in Europe in terms of average income generation, the
article describes the dire realities that beset the once
sleeping-giant-turned-global-power. Using Hong Kong as the standard by which to
measure <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/2014/10/30/hendren-global-group-top-facts-on-asias-contribution-to-the-global-economy-is-playing-catch-up-good/">economic
growth</a>, average incomes dip to 50% in Shenzhen, to 25% in Guandong and to a
mere 10% in Yunnan. That is an overall average of less than 30% that of Hong
Kong, which is essentially a small dot of an island compared to the gigantic
mainland China teeming with so many millions of people.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">The
average annual rate of growth from 2000 to 2009 for developing nations was
7.6%, 4.5% higher than that seen in <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/">developed
rich nations</a>. That unprecedented rate practically narrowed down the gap
between the developed and developing countries.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">The
once deprived populations of the world, a big majority of whom are found in
Asia and living on less than the global poverty level of $1.25 daily income,
surged on from a share of 30% of the world population in 2000 to less than 10%
as of April 2014, according to the <a href="http://hendrenglobalgroup.blogspot.com/">Center for Global Development</a>
based on new date from the World Bank. At that pace, it is estimated that in
only 30 years, the average income per person would converge with that in
America. This is certainly cause for great hope for many people on a global
scale.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">Sad to
say, those hopes are now slipping away. An evaluation of data on GDP per person
based on new computations of cost of living released in April by the World
Bank’s International Comparison Programme (ICP) seems to show that convergence
has slowed down drastically.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">Since
2008, growth rates across the emerging nations have slowed down and matched
those in developed economies. When the new ICP figures are applied, the average
GDP per capita in the emerging world, measured on a purchasing-power-parity
(PPP) basis, grew just 2.6 percentage points faster than American GDP in 2013.
If China is removed from the estimates, the difference is only 1.1%. At that
rate, convergence with rich-economy incomes will occur in a hundred years or
more, longer than a generation. If China is included, emerging economies could
expect to reach rich-world income levels, on average, in a little over
half-a-century.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: "Tahoma","sans-serif"; font-size: 12.0pt;">Japan,
which achieved industrialization in the first part of the 20th century, grew to
be the world’s second largest economy, next to USA. South Korea, Taiwan and
several city-states like Singapore and Hong Kong also grew and developed into
prosperous nations. The rush to achieve levels of growth close to those of
developing nations became an addiction to these nations and others who needed
to catch up as well. The price paid in terms of investments on human capital
led to social and political problems as some nations had to export their
workers to the industrialized or more prosperous nations. Ironically, the
income generated by those workers help to sustain those nations during the
crises that transpired.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><br /></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">In
trying to explain the growth disparity, economists pointed to institutions
being the key while others focused on “geography and climate”. Moreover, they
said that “remoteness from economic centers and hot, disease-prone conditions
could retard development,” which is the case in many of the Southeast Asian
countries where the issues of rebellion and ethnic differences provide
obstacles to development of the depressed country-sides.</span></div>

So Why Are They in Decline?<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 2.95pt 1.85pt; text-indent: -0.25in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<!--[if !supportLists]--><span lang="EN-PH" style="font-family: Symbol; font-size: 10.0pt; mso-bidi-font-family: Symbol; mso-bidi-font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Symbol;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">·<span style="font-family: 'Times New Roman'; font-size: 7pt;">
</span></span><!--[endif]--><span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">It is the
perfect and simple plan: provide qualified employees to employers. Indeed, apprenticeships
allow workers to acquire the very skills they need. But why are apprenticeships
on the wane? <o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 2.95p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 2.95p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<b><span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">Here is the story:<o:p></o:p></span></b></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 2.95p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: .0001pt; margin-bottom: 0in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">When you
ask CEOs and corporate manpower staff whether they get the right kind
of workers they need, they will complain about a gap in employee abilities that
put productivity and growth at risk — not only inside their organizations but also
in the greater economy.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: .0001pt; margin-bottom: 0in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 0.0001pt; text-indent: -0.25in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<!--[if !supportLists]--><span lang="EN-PH" style="font-family: Symbol; font-size: 10.0pt; mso-bidi-font-family: Symbol; mso-bidi-font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Symbol;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">·<span style="font-family: 'Times New Roman'; font-size: 7pt;">
</span></span><!--[endif]--><span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">However,
employers and state lawmakers have been distinctly half-hearted about a tested
solution to the pressing issue: apprenticeships.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;"><a href="http://online.wsj.com/news/articles/SB10001424052702303978304579473501943642612?mod=trending_now_4">Apprenticeships</a>
can provide a perfect marriage of the skills employers look for and the
training workers derive, states Robert Lerman, an American University economics
professor.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: .0001pt; margin-bottom: 0in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">"It
is a great model for passing on skills from one generation to the next," declares
John Ladd, director of the Department of Labor's Office of Apprenticeship.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: .0001pt; margin-bottom: 0in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">Nonetheless, as the Labor Department
announces, formal programs that unite on-the-job training with mentorships and
classroom education went down 40% in the U.S. from 2003 to 2013.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">Which leads us to ask the
question: If the solution to this crucial problem lies in apprenticeships, how
come so much resistance exists?<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 2.95p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 2.95p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<b><i><span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">Blue-Collar Image<o:p></o:p></span></i></b></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 2.95p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">It seems the biggest constraint
is that two-thirds of apprenticeship programs in the U.S. apply in the
construction industry, projecting a blue-collar image that dampens enthusiasm
among young people and the companies which could provide jobs for them.
Construction unions, which have wide influence among many of the state agencies
concerning apprenticeships, have not done enough to reach out to other
industries, Mr. Lerman says.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: .0001pt; margin-bottom: 0in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">Likewise, entrepreneurs and
managers oftentimes avoid apprenticeships because of their connection with
unions. "There's an underlying fear among employers" that unions want
to interfere by organizing workers, or that any apprenticeship plan might
be controlled by a union, says J. Ronald De Juliis, labor and industry head
at Maryland's Department of Labor.</span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: .0001pt; margin-bottom: 0in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br />
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;"></span></div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hfiUgJQnpGpGcxf65UR_GwK-qquOXWKvQ12Wcb4QfGfsIW_xLcs9s84r8n0rSt-fndfncTOSB7GM1bRznuOXMV7XqUWzjOYrE-rfg8AfiaaU831XIK1Hgx4Oblt5uAQdz9XjgePA4RmLk/s1600/iuoli.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="margin-left: 1em; margin-right: 1em;"><img border="0"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hfiUgJQnpGpGcxf65UR_GwK-qquOXWKvQ12Wcb4QfGfsIW_xLcs9s84r8n0rSt-fndfncTOSB7GM1bRznuOXMV7XqUWzjOYrE-rfg8AfiaaU831XIK1Hgx4Oblt5uAQdz9XjgePA4RmLk/s1600/iuoli.jpg" height="172" width="320" /></a></div>
<br />
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 2.95p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: .0001pt; margin-bottom: 0in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">However, De
Juliis and others admit, things can be entirely different. At present, apprenticeships
involve many more industries than the few trades that welcomed the
earn-and-learn paradigm starting in 1937 when the National Apprenticeship Act
was implemented. Nursing aides, wastewater technicians and computer-system managers
are a few of the jobs for which apprentices can find training in.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: .0001pt; margin-bottom: 0in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">At the beginning of this month,
President Obama allocated $100 million for apprenticeship programs in
high-growth industries, and acknowledged new programs in information technology,
health care and supply-chain management.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">Still, another constraint is a commonly
held idea that young people should remain in school and then find a job. Supporters
of apprenticeship programs believe this view is ill-advised.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">College degrees and internships
do not generate the same quality of worker as thorough, hands-on apprenticeships,
states director Brad Neese of Apprenticeship Carolina, a program of the South
Carolina Technical College System. Companies are seeing "a genuine lack of
applicability when it concerns skill level" from college graduates, Mr.
Neese says. "Interns do grunt work, generally." However, he says,
"an apprenticeship is a real job."<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">Moreover, some companies are
anxious that employees will leave for better-paying jobs right after they have acquired
their necessary skills. For them, an apprenticeship is like training workers
for other companies to ultimately benefit from.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">In many cases, however, employers
discover that apprenticeships actually encourage retention, as workers who go
through apprenticeship programs realize the investment their employers put into
their professional growth and repay the good turn with a greater sense of
loyalty.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">"The apprenticeship paradigm
allows us to convince people there is a career path within this company,"
says Robby Hill, owner of HillSouth, a Florence, S.C., technology consulting company
making good use of South Carolina's on-the-job training program. <o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">New employees envision doors
opening for them in the future, along with a distinctly programmed ladder of
skills training and salary improvements, says Mr. Hill, whose 22-person company
provides apprenticeships for IT and administrative-support workers. The company
also requests employees to enter into a non-compete agreement as they get certified
for new skills.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 2.95p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<b><i><span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">Innovative Thinking<o:p></o:p></span></i></b></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">Advocates of apprenticeships claim
that joining on-the-job training with related education and benchmarks can be undertaken
in any job. They cite programs in states such as South Carolina and Wisconsin
as getting positive output.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: .0001pt; margin-bottom: 0in;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">There are
now apprenticeships for computer professionals and registered nursing aides in
South Carolina, where the number of businesses providing apprenticeships has increased
to 647 from only 90 in 2007. About 4,700 workers who underwent South Carolina's
apprentice program are now employed full-time.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">To get employers engaged in
apprenticeships, the state provides a $1,000 yearly tax credit for every
apprentice included in the payroll. "That opens the door somehow," states
Mr. Neese. "For a small business, the credit can erase the education expenses
for an apprentice program.”<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">"We have endeavored to make
the tax credit as user-friendly as we can," he adds. "We have a very short
one-page form that simply asks, 'How many apprentices are in your firm?' and
then you multiple the number by $1,000."<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">Wisconsin, which has presently
almost 8,000 apprentices, is working to augment training positions for such
tasks as truck driving as well as high-tech manufacturing.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">"We are anticipating employee
deficits in health care and advanced manufacturing," claims director Karen
Morgan of Wisconsin's Bureau of Apprenticeship Standards. The Governor's
Council on Workforce Investment is considering some steps to solve the problem,
she says. The state is launching some programs to apply robotics and high-level
welding to its normal apprenticeship training.</span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="line-height: 16.8pt; margin-bottom: 12.0pt; vertical-align: baseline;">
<span lang="EN-PH" style="font-size: 12.0pt; mso-fareast-font-family: "Times New Roman"; mso-fareast-language: EN-PH;">"We are making our programs
more adaptable," Ms. Morgan says, to highlight to manufacturers the importance
that apprenticeships can provide for a sector experiencing fast modernization.<o:p></o:p></span></div>

<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/2013/11/09/city-must-shrink-if-era-of-too-big-to-fail-doesnt-end-says-mark-carney/">http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/2013/11/09/city-must-shrink-if-era-of-too-big-to-fail-doesnt-end-says-mark-carney/</a><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">The
Governor of the Bank of England has said Britain will have to give up its
leading position in financial services unless the UK’s “too big to fail” banks
can go bust without putting the taxpayer at risk.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">The
City would have to shrink if the <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/category/top-facts/politics-government/">Government</a>
were to come to the rescue of banks in a future crisis, Mark Carney has warned.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">“If
we don’t end ‘too big to fail’, we can’t support a financial sector of this
size,” he said.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">Despite
the fact that the financial services industry accounts for 10pc of national
output, UK banks have assets equivalent to about four times the size of the <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/category/top-facts/economics/">economy</a>,
employing around 1m people.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">By
2050, banks assets could be nine times the size of UK GDP if “UK-owned banks’
share of global banking activity remains the same”, Mr Carney said.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">“Some
would react to this prospect with horror… but, if organised properly, a vibrant
financial sector brings substantial benefits. The UK’s financial sector can be
both a global good and a national asset – if it is resilient.”</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">To
get there, he called for greater co-operation between national supervisors to
prevent “regulatory Balkanisation” caused as countries put their own interests
first. Failure to strike an international accord on financial regulation would
threaten London’s competitiveness as a <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/category/top-facts/money/">global financial</a>
centre, he warned.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">The
Bank had overhauled its liquidity rules to ensure the real economy was never
again starved of lending in a financial crisis, the Governor also revealed. He
assured that banks and building societies would have low-priced and abundant
access to liquidity even if markets seized up, as they did during the 2008
credit crunch.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">“Five
simple words describe our approach – we are open for business,” he said. The
Bank has reformed Britain’s “sterling monetary framework” to prevent banks from
hoarding unproductive cash and gilts that could otherwise be released for
lending to households and <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/category/top-facts/entrepreneurship/">businesses</a>.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">“We
are changing how we backstop private firms’ liquidity management,” Mr Carney
said, after giving a speech in London. “These efforts will help set the stage
to improve further the supply of credit within the UK.”</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">In
2008, a scarcity of liquidity forced banks into emergency asset sales that
degenerate the crisis by setting off a downward spiral in prices. Since then,
regulators have brought in tough liquidity rules but banks have built up even
larger buffers – tying up funds.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">The
Bank relaxed its regulations in June to release as much as £70bn of liquidity
to help boost lending and drive economic growth. The most recent change will
guarantee lenders can be confident that they will always be able to access cash
and gilts.</span></div>
<br />
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;">To
build the fresh arrangements striking to lenders, the Bank has removed the
“stigma” of liquidity assistance by cutting the fees and approving to accept
lower quality loans as collateral.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 12p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>

<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">Seagate Technology said
that it is now shipping the industry’s first enterprise solid state hybrid
drive (SSHD), the Seagate Enterprise Turbo SSHD. It incorporates the NAND flash
of an SSD with the spinning magnetic platters of a mechanical HDD, building a
single storage solution with high-speed data transfers and huge storage
capacities. As comparing with the existing 15K RPM drives on the market, the
end-users will supposedly see up to triple the random performance compared to.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">June this year, the news arrives
after Seagate and IBM introduced the IBM G2HS Hybrid and the IBM G2SS Hybrid as
storage options for the IBM Series X Servers. The two were 2.5 inch drives that
provided 600 GB of storage, 16 GB of eMLC NAND Flash and a 128 MB DRAM data
buffer. There are also other features such as 10K RPM platter speeds, a SAS
interface, a drive-to-host interface that supports up to 6 Gbps, and a drive
media to buffer interface. The average sustained transfer rate was 151 MB/s and
the average rotational latency was 2.9 ms.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">“Over the past year,
Seagate and IBM have been putting an enterprise SSHD prototype through its
paces,” the company said. “After months of testing in Seagate and IBM labs, the
first enterprise SSHD has been introduced.”</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">According to Seagate, the
new Enterprise Turbo SSHD drive caches at the I/O level, thus addressing
performance gaps and bottlenecks often found in tiered system environments. A
self-encrypting drive option to maximize security for data-at-rest, and up to
600 GB of storage, the highest enterprise performance drive available today is
also being offered.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">The Enterprise Turbo SSHD
enables lower cost server and storage configurations, making it appealing for
OEMs and system builders who demand the highest, scalable performance at an affordable
cost, Seagate added. Since it’s extremely efficient and economical, the drive
provides a significantly improved dollar to IOPS ratio.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">“Typically the most
demanding mission critical applications for 15K drives have improved
performance by compromising on capacity and cost per GB,” said Rocky Pimentel,
Seagate executive vice president and chief sales and marketing officer. “With
the Enterprise Turbo SSHD, we deliver a no compromise drive that provides
high-speed performance while enabling customers to leverage all of Turbo’s
capacity.”</span></div>
<br />
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">Seagate said that a 10K RPM
version of an enterprise SSHD boasts IOPS over two times better than a standard
600 GB 10K RPM hard disk drive basing on results presented by the Storage
Performance Council. The company added “the end result is much improved and
more cost effective performance for servers running mission critical
applications such as big data analytics, virtual desktop infrastructure, and
database and transaction processing.”</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>

<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">The decrease in the
official rate of unemployment hides the level at which American employees face
a very bleak future in labor. A big part of the improvement in the unemployment
rate merely shows an increase in the number of disheartened or “marginally
attached” workers (people seeking jobs who have ceased doing so). The portion
of the workforce holding part-time jobs involuntarily has also grown.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">Such drop in the demand for
labor, besides the waning power of unions and the slashes in salary demanded by
both public and private employers (frequently associated with outsourcing or,
at public employers, privatizing), keeps down — or further depresses — incomes
that had not improved much even from 2000 to 2007, when the recession set in.
Between 2007 and 2012, while productivity improved by 7.7 percent, salaries
dipped for the lowest 70 percent of the workforce, according to a report
released recently by the <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/category/top-facts/economics/">Economic
Policy Institute</a> through its researchers Lawrence Mishel and Heidi
Shierholz.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">The weakness of the labor
movement, particularly in rising, low-income sectors like retail and fast-food,
is responsible for much of the decline; but the waning value of the minimum
wage holds a big role. According to another recent EPI study, by Sylvia
Allegretto and Steven C. Pitts, if the federal <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/category/top-facts/politics-government/">government</a>
reinstituted the minimum salary to its maximum rate in 1968, the minimum salary
would be $9.44 at present in inflation-adjusted dollars, not $7.25. And if it
corresponded in real terms the $2.00 minimum salary demanded 50 years ago by
the March on Washington, the minimum wage would be $13.39 — close to the
striking fast-food workers’ demand and to the minimum in many advanced
countries (about $12 per hour in France and $15 per hour in Australia, for cite
a few). If the minimum salary had increased as much as labor productivity since
1968, it would be $22 per hour.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">Any increase in the federal
minimum would principally aid people of color and women, Allegretto and Pitts
say. Contrary to stereotypes of low-income employees such as teenagers, a hike
would benefit many adult, family-earning workers. In a report for EPI published
in March, David Cooper and Dan Essrow estimated that with even the slight
$10.10 minimum proposed by Sen. Tom Harkin (D-Iowa) and Rep. George Miller
(D-Calif.), the mean age of low-wage employees whose wage would likely increase
is 35. Eighty-eight percent are above 20 years old, and 35.5 percent are 40
years old or more. Moreover, 44 percent of the beneficiaries would be employees
with some college schooling, and 28 percent with offspring.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">The predicament of
low-salary workers is turning into an even more severe problem as the country’s
occupational structure, that is, the types of jobs being created or maintained,
has altered. According to Daniel Alpert of the Century Foundation, 70 percent
of the jobs created in the second quarter of 2013 were low-salary, such as
retail and hospitality jobs, about twice the percentage of such jobs in the
general workforce. And over 50 percent of all fresh jobs in the first semester
of 2013 were part-time.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">Incomes have grown for the
highest 5 percent, however, chiefly, the wealthiest. The <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/">top</a> 1 percent — principally, executives and
financial managers — garnered 121 percent of the country’s new income within
the first two years of the recovery, according to University of California,
Berkeley economist Emanuel Saez. How do they do that? Essentially, they siphon
all national income proceeds to themselves while concurrently capturing more
from the 99 percent.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">Observing more closely
shows an even uglier picture. The success of the very rich frequently involves
large components of chicanery, deception and misuse of public resources,
according to a fresh study, “Bailed Out, Booted, Busted,” the 20th yearly Labor
Day publication of the Executive Excess reports from the Institute for Policy
Studies. The researchers gathered information from 20 years of their studies,
which depended on yearly Wall Street Journal surveys of CEO compensation.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;">Their ultimate survey
involved 500 CEOS — the 25 highest-paid CEOs annually for twenty years. IPS
reports that 38 percent of these CEOs had performed very badly as executives of
their companies. Of those poor performers, 22 percent of the top salary leaders
brought their companies into bankruptcy or bailout; 8 percent were fired (but
received golden parachutes worth an average of $38 million); and 8 percent were
convicted of fraud.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>

<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">Zhang
Yuwei in New York (China Daily)-China is set to sign the tax-assistance
convention with the Organization for Economic Cooperation and Development
(OECD) on Tuesday and will become the last in the Group of 20 <a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/category/top-facts/economics/">economies</a>
to enter the major global convention on tax.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">On
Tuesday, China’s tax head Wang Jun will sign the convention in Paris, which
will be in force after three full calendar-months from its ratification. The
convention — entitled Multilateral Convention on Mutual Administrative
Assistance in Tax Matters – stipulates a structure for administrative
collaboration between over 50 developing and developed nations in determining
and collecting taxes, with emphasis on controlling tax evasion and avoidance.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">China’s
inclusion in the group ratifying the convention signifies the world’s
second-largest economy participating “in international efforts to fight tax
avoidance and evasion by coordinating with other countries in the assessment
and collection of taxes”, according to OECD.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">Upon
the convention’s full enforcement with respect to China, the country’s tax
officials will be allowed to request their counterparts from the participating
nations for use of their tax records and vice versa.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">Steven
Zhang, managing director at Fund Tax Services LLC in New York, said China’s
entrance to the group is “in keeping with a worldwide pattern”.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">“China’s
concurrence with the objectives of the convention would enhance the efficiency
of Chinese tax officials in quelling potential tax avoidance and evasion by
foreigners and foreign enterprises,” said Zhang.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">Tax
evasion was also a main concern set by world leaders, together with the leaders
from the G20 economies, to tackle the causes of the 2008 financial catastrophe
and to help eradicate corruption – one of the primary issues China’s new
government has resolved to tackle with determination.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">Tax
evasion and avoidance will be one of the chief matters under consideration at
the G20 summit in St. Petersburg on Sept 5-6.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">“<a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/category/top-facts/politics-government/">Governments
all over the world</a> are implementing laws and policies to enforce taxpayers
to show greater transparency in their tax reporting and are increasing
coordination in fighting tax avoidance over various jurisdictions,” said Zhang.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">“Escalating
pressure from nations and enforcers has put administration of international tax
risk at the frontline of company and financial decisions,” he added.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">Global
<a href="http://hendrengroup.biz/blog/category/top-facts/entrepreneurship/">Financial
Integrity</a>, a non-profit advocacy and research group based in Washington,
said the Chinese economy bled $3.79 trillion in illegal investment outflows
from 2000 through 2011. Out of about $2.83 trillion that drained unlawfully out
of China from 2005 to 2011, they said, $595.8 billion ended up as bank deposits
or financial assets – such as bonds, stocks, derivatives, and mutual funds -in
tax shelters.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">Statistics
provided by China’s State Administration of Taxation last month revealed that
anti-tax evasion moves by the Chinese government produced an additional income
of about $5.7 billion last year, almost 30 times the figure of 2008.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">The
convention was developed jointly by the OECD and the Council of Europe in 1988.
In 2009, the accord was rationalized to make it conform with international
requirements on the transfer of information for tax purposes, and to allow
nations that were not part of the OECD or the Council of Europe to join in.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<br /></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t;">
<span lang="EN" style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;">Over
50 nations have either entered as signatories or have expressed their desire to
do so since the revision of the convention.</span><span style="font-family: Tahoma, sans-serif; font-size: 10pt;"><o:p></o:p></span></div>
